The far left column (Sample) provides the designator for each sample (P1–P6). The second column (VH gene) lists the germline Ig VH genes that have the highest homology with the Ig VH genes isolated from each sample. The percent homology column lists the percent sequence homology between the isolated VH gene and the deduced germline VH gene having the highest base sequence homology. The Anticipated Phenotype column provides the expected reactivity of the surface Ig with the anti-CRI or anti-VH subgroup reagents. The columns labeled SpA, B6, Lc1, or μ provide the observed MFIR of the leukemia cell population stained with each of these reagents relative to that of the cells stained with an isotype control mAb. N.T., sample was not tested.
